Mechel acquires mining dump trucks from BelAZ

Tuesday, 24 April 2012 17:22:25 (GMT+3)   |  
       

Mechel, one of the leading Russian mining and metals companies, has announced that it has acquired 15 BelAZ mining dump trucks as part of the long-term partnership agreement signed by Mechel and Belarusian manufacturer of haulage and earthmoving equipment BelAZ in November, 2011.

The new mining dump trucks will be used at the Nerungrinsk open pit and the Elga coal complex owned by Yakutugol Holding Company and at the Korshunovsk mine of Korshunov Mining Plant. The trucks will be delivered by the end of the second quarter of the current year.
